Step 1: Gentle Cleansing
- Product:
Pai Skincare Light Work Rosehip Cleansing Oil. Yes, an oil cleanser in the morning! This might sound counterintuitive, but hear me out. After a night of sleep, my skin doesn't need a harsh strip; it needs a gentle refresh. This beautiful cleansing oil melts away any residual night products and prepares my skin without ever making it feel tight or dry. Its incredibly calming and has a delicate, natural scent that just makes me feel good. I simply massage a few pumps onto dry skin, add a little water to emulsify, and then rinse off with a warm, damp cloth. It leaves my skin soft, plump, and ready for the next steps, especially important when I know I'm facing the varied elements of a Toronto day.

Step 3: Antioxidant Serum
- Product:
True Botanicals Vitamin C Booster. City life, even in a relatively green city like Toronto, means exposure to environmental stressors. This Vitamin C powder (which you mix with a few drops of their Renew Nutrient Mist, or any other serum) is my shield. Vitamin C is a powerhouse antioxidant that brightens the skin, helps even out tone, and protects against free radical damage. I mix a tiny pinch into a few drops of my mist or serum right in my palm and press it into my skin. It feels incredibly potent and effective, giving me peace of mind knowing my skin is protected as I navigate the busy streets or even just commute on the TTC.

Step 1: Double Cleanse (The Non-Negotiable)
- Product:
Pai Skincare Light Work Rosehip Cleansing Oil. Yes, the same one! This is my first cleanse to melt away all the makeup, sunscreen, and grime of the day. A generous pump, massaged onto dry skin, really breaks down everything. Its especially satisfying after a long day of shooting content, feeling the city residue just lift away. I spend a good minute massaging it in, then rinse thoroughly.
- Product:
Drunk Elephant Beste No. 9 Jelly Cleanser. For my second cleanse, I reach for this gentle gel cleanser. It's pH-balanced and removes any last traces of impurities without stripping my skin. It lathers lightly and rinses clean, leaving my skin feeling incredibly fresh and prepared for treatments. Its simple, effective, and doesnt contain any of the "suspicious six" ingredients that Drunk Elephant avoids, which aligns perfectly with my natural philosophy. This duo truly gets my skin squeaky clean without ever making it feel dry C crucial, especially in the dry indoor air of a Toronto winter.
Step 2: Treatment Serum
- Product:
Biossance Squalane + Phyto-Retinol Serum. As I've gotten older, I've become more interested in gentle yet effective anti-aging solutions. I steer clear of traditional retinols due to sensitivity, but this "phyto-retinol" (Bakuchiol, a plant-derived alternative) serum is a genuinely useful. It helps to reduce the appearance of fine lines and improve skin texture without any irritation. Its incredibly hydrating thanks to the squalane, which is a hero ingredient for my skin. I press a few drops onto my face and neck, letting it sink in while I maybe catch up on a show or scroll through my favourite Toronto Instagram accounts.
